Hi Kris,

I'm using a VanGorden all band dipole which is nothing more that a 135 foot
dipole fed with 450 ohm ladder line.  You need a tuner and a ballon with
this type of antenna, but it works GREAT on all bands through 10 meters for
me.  When I was in college, I ran a no seeom dipole made out of 26 gage wire
and 1/8 inch dowels and it worked.

The most visible part of this all band antenna is the ladder line, a
vertical would probably be the least noticeable, but then there are those
radials.  And, remember, your support center pole or vertical can also serve
as your flag pole!
